About Bachelor's Degree or Higher

Covington County, Alabama has a bachelor's degree or higher of 17.2%, ranking #2,467 of 3,222 counties nationwide — 49.1% below the national value of 33.7%. Within Alabama, it ranks #34 of 67. This places it in the 23th percentile nationally.

Percentage of the population aged 25+ with a bachelor's degree or higher. Source: U.S. Census Bureau, American Community Survey 2024 5-Year Estimates. All values are estimates derived from survey samples and are subject to margin of error. For more information, see our methodology.
